Les 3 Vallées is home to the resorts of Courchevel, La Tania, Méribel, Brides-Les-Bains, Les Menuires – Saint Martin, Val Thorens and Orelle.

The world’s largest ski area, it is linked together by ski runs and ski lifts, with 600 kms of interconnected slopes and 172 ski lifts.

These 8 different resorts offer a vast array of accommodation, ranging from low cost options to prestigious 5 star ratings.
